Frequently Asked Questions About Assisted Living in Fargo
Common questions families have when exploring assisted living options in Fargo, Georgia.
What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Fargo, GA?
In Fargo, GA, assisted living costs are generally lower than the national average due to the rural nature of the area. On average, you can expect monthly costs to range from $2,500 to $3,800, depending on the level of care, amenities, and specific facility. It's advisable to contact local facilities directly for precise pricing, as Fargo has limited options and costs can vary.
Are there any assisted living facilities located directly in Fargo, GA?
Fargo, GA is a very small, rural city with a limited number of dedicated assisted living facilities. Residents often look to nearby larger towns such as Valdosta or Homerville for more options. It's recommended to use Georgia's Department of Community Health website or contact the Fargo city hall for a current list of licensed residential care homes or assisted living providers serving the area.
What types of care and services are typically offered by assisted living facilities in the Fargo, GA area?
Assisted living facilities serving Fargo, GA typically provide help with activities of daily living (ADLs) like bathing, dressing, and medication management. Many also offer meal services, housekeeping, and social activities. Due to the rural setting, some facilities might have arrangements with local healthcare providers in Clinch County for additional medical services, but specialized memory care may require travel to a larger city.
How are assisted living facilities regulated and licensed in Georgia, and does this apply to Fargo?
All assisted living facilities in Georgia, including those serving Fargo, must be licensed by the Healthcare Facility Regulation Division of the Georgia Department of Community Health. They must comply with state rules regarding staffing, safety, and resident care. You can verify a facility's license and review any inspection reports through the state's online portal to ensure the provider meets Georgia's regulatory standards.
What local resources in or near Fargo, GA can help families choose an assisted living facility?
Families in Fargo can contact the Clinch County Senior Center or the Area Agency on Aging for South Georgia (which covers Clinch County) for information and referrals. These resources can provide lists of licensed facilities, advice on paying for care, and may offer support services. Additionally, reaching out to primary care physicians at local clinics in Homerville or Valdosta can provide medical insights relevant to choosing appropriate care in the region.
